<d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><s id="yhprb"><strike id="yhprb"></strike></s></dfn><small id="yhprb"></small><dfn id="yhprb"></dfn><small id="yhprb"><delect id="yhprb"></delect></small><small id="yhprb"></small><small id="yhprb"></small> <delect id="yhprb"><strike id="yhprb"></strike></delect><dfn id="yhprb"></dfn><dfn id="yhprb"></dfn><s id="yhprb"><noframes id="yhprb"><small id="yhprb"><dfn id="yhprb"></dfn></small><dfn id="yhprb"><delect id="yhprb"></delect></dfn><small id="yhprb"></small><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n> <small id="yhprb"></small><delect id="yhprb"><strike id="yhprb"></strike></delect><d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"><s id="yhprb"><strike id="yhprb"></strike></s></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n>

新聞中心

EEPW首頁(yè) > 嵌入式系統 > 設計應用 > TMS320C6678存儲器訪(fǎng)問(wèn)性能(上)

TMS320C6678存儲器訪(fǎng)問(wèn)性能(上)

—— TMS320C6678存儲器訪(fǎng)問(wèn)性能
作者: 時(shí)間:2015-06-27 來(lái)源:網(wǎng)絡(luò ) 收藏

  摘要

本文引用地址:http://dyxdggzs.com/article/276392.htm

   有8 個(gè)C66x核,典型速度是1GHz,每個(gè)核有 32KB L1D SRAM,32KB L1P SRAM和512KB LL2 SRAM;所有 DSP核共享4MB SL2 SRAM。一個(gè)64-bit 1333MTS DDR3 SDRAM接口可以支持8GB外部擴展。

  訪(fǎng)問(wèn)性能對DSP上運行的軟件是非常關(guān)鍵的。在C6678 DSP上,所有的主模塊,包括多個(gè)DSP核和多個(gè)DMA都可以訪(fǎng)問(wèn)所有的。

  每個(gè)DSP核每個(gè)時(shí)鐘周期都可以執行最多128 bits的load或store操作。在1GHz的時(shí)鐘頻率下,DSP核訪(fǎng)問(wèn)L1D SRAM的帶寬可以達到16GB/S。

  DSP的內部總線(xiàn)交換網(wǎng)絡(luò ),TeraNet,提供了C66x核(包括其本地存儲器),外部存儲器,EDMA控制器,和片上外設之間的互連總共有10個(gè)EDMA傳輸控制器可以被配置起來(lái)同時(shí)執行任意存儲器之間的數據傳輸。

  本文為設計人員提供存儲器訪(fǎng)問(wèn)性能評估的基本信息;提供各種操作條件下的性能測試數據;還探討了影響存儲器訪(fǎng)問(wèn)性能的一些因素。

  1. 存儲器系統簡(jiǎn)介

  有8個(gè)C66x核,每個(gè)核有:

  32KB L1D(Level 1 Data) SRAM,它和DSP核運行在相同的速度上,可以被用作普通的數據存儲器或數據cache。

  32KB L1P(Level 1 Program) SRAM,它和DSP核運行在相同的速度上,可以被用作普通的程序存儲器或程序cache。

  512KB LL2(Local Level 2)SRAM,它的運行速度是DSP核的一半,可以被用作普通存儲器或cache,既可以存放數據也可以存放程序。

  所有DSP核共享4MB SL2(Shared Level 2)SRAM,它的運行速度是DSP核的一半,既可以存放數據也可以存放程序。集成一個(gè)64-bit 1333MTS DDR3 SDRAM接口,可以支持8GB外部擴展存儲器,既可以存放數據也可以存放程序。它的總線(xiàn)寬度也可以被配置成32bits或16bits。

  存儲器訪(fǎng)問(wèn)性能對DSP上軟件運行的效率是非常關(guān)鍵的。在C6678 DSP上,所有的主模塊,包括多個(gè)DSP核和多個(gè)DMA都可以訪(fǎng)問(wèn)所有的存儲器。

  每個(gè)DSP核每個(gè)時(shí)鐘周期都可以執行最多128 bits 的load 或store操作。在1GHz的時(shí)鐘頻率下,DSP核訪(fǎng)問(wèn)L1D SRAM 的帶寬可以達到16GB/S。當訪(fǎng)問(wèn)二級(L2)存儲器或外部存儲器時(shí),訪(fǎng)問(wèn)性能主要取決于訪(fǎng)問(wèn)的方式和cache。

  每個(gè)DSP核有一個(gè)內部DMA (IDMA),在1GHz的時(shí)鐘頻率下,它能支持高達8GB/秒的傳輸。但IDMA只能訪(fǎng)問(wèn)L1和LL2以及配置寄存器,它不能訪(fǎng)問(wèn)外部存儲器。

  DSP的內部總線(xiàn)交換網(wǎng)絡(luò ),TeraNet,提供了C66x核 (包括其本地存儲器) ,外部存儲器, EDMA控制器,和片上外設之間的互聯(lián)??偣灿?0個(gè)EDMA傳輸控制器可以被配置起來(lái)同時(shí)執行任意存儲器之間的數據傳輸。芯片內部有兩個(gè)主要的TeraNet模塊,一個(gè)用128 bit總線(xiàn)連接每個(gè)端點(diǎn),速度是DSP 核頻率的1/3,理論上,在1GHz的器件上每個(gè)端口支持 5.333GB/秒的帶寬;另一個(gè)TeraNet內部總線(xiàn)交換網(wǎng)絡(luò )用256 bit總線(xiàn)連接每個(gè)端點(diǎn),速度是DSP核頻率的1/2,理論上,在1GHz的器件上每個(gè)端口支持16GB/秒的帶寬。

  總共有10個(gè)EDMA傳輸控制器可以被配置起來(lái)同時(shí)執行任意存儲器之間的數據傳輸。它們中的兩個(gè)連接到256-bit, 1/2 DSP核速度的 TeraNet內部總線(xiàn)交換網(wǎng)絡(luò );另外8個(gè)連接到128-bit, 1/3 DSP核速度的TeraNet內部總線(xiàn)交換網(wǎng)絡(luò )。

  圖1展示了TMS320C6678的存儲器系統??偩€(xiàn)上的數字代表它的寬度。大部分模塊運行速度是DSP核時(shí)鐘的1/n,DDR的典型速度是1333MTS(Million Transfer per Second)。

  

 

  圖1 TMS320C6678 存儲器系統

  本文為設計人員提供存儲器訪(fǎng)問(wèn)性能評估的基本信息;提供各種操作條件下的性能測試數據;還探討了影響存儲器訪(fǎng)問(wèn)性能的一些因素。

  本文對分析以下常見(jiàn)問(wèn)題會(huì )有所幫助:

  1. 應該用DSP核還是DMA來(lái)拷貝數據?

  2. 一個(gè)頻繁訪(fǎng)問(wèn)存儲器的函數會(huì )消耗多少時(shí)鐘周期?

  3. 當多個(gè)主模塊共享存儲器時(shí),對某個(gè)模塊的性能會(huì )有多大的影響?

  本文中的大部分數據是在C6678 EVM(EValuation Module)板上測試得到的,它上面有64-bit 1333MTS的DDR 存儲器。

  2. DSP核,EDMA3,IDMA拷貝數據的性能比較

  數據拷貝的帶寬由下面三個(gè)因素中最差的一個(gè)決定:

  1. 總線(xiàn)帶寬

  2. 源端吞吐量

  3. 目的端吞吐量

  表1 總結了C6678 上C66x 核,IDMA 和EDMA 的理論帶寬。

  

 

  表1 1GHz C6678上C66x核,IDMA和EDMA的理論帶寬

  表2 總結了C6678 EVM(64-bit 1333MTS DDR)上各種存儲器端口的理論帶寬。

  

 

  表2 1GHz C6678上各種存儲器端口的理論帶寬

存儲器相關(guān)文章:存儲器原理



上一頁(yè) 1 2 3 下一頁(yè)

關(guān)鍵詞: TMS320C6678 存儲器

評論


相關(guān)推薦

技術(shù)專(zhuān)區

關(guān)閉
国产精品自在自线亚洲|国产精品无圣光一区二区|国产日产欧洲无码视频|久久久一本精品99久久K精品66|欧美人与动牲交片免费播放
<d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><s id="yhprb"><strike id="yhprb"></strike></s></dfn><small id="yhprb"></small><dfn id="yhprb"></dfn><small id="yhprb"><delect id="yhprb"></delect></small><small id="yhprb"></small><small id="yhprb"></small> <delect id="yhprb"><strike id="yhprb"></strike></delect><dfn id="yhprb"></dfn><dfn id="yhprb"></dfn><s id="yhprb"><noframes id="yhprb"><small id="yhprb"><dfn id="yhprb"></dfn></small><dfn id="yhprb"><delect id="yhprb"></delect></dfn><small id="yhprb"></small><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n> <small id="yhprb"></small><delect id="yhprb"><strike id="yhprb"></strike></delect><d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"><s id="yhprb"><strike id="yhprb"></strike></s></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n>